i noted that postscreen do dnsbl test on pregreet connections
The dnsbl test is done when you enabled dnsbl tests and the result
from a previous dnsbl test has expired.

the first dnsbl is wasted on first pregreet ?

eq if connection is already pregreet, why still make dnsbl test then ?

also if connection ip is known in cache, why pregreet test again ?

The pregreet test done when you enabled pregreet tests and the result
from a previous pregreet test has expired.
